Sinking foundation repair services address issues caused by soil movement, water damage, or poor construction that lead to the downward shifting of a building’s foundation. These repairs typically involve stabilizing the structure through methods such as underpinning, piering, or mudjacking, which aim to restore stability and prevent further settling. Projects often include residential homes, basements, or additions that show signs of uneven floors, cracked walls, or sticking doors and windows, all of which can indicate foundation movement. Common Sinking Foundation Repair Jobs

Foundation underpinning - stabilizes a sinking foundation to prevent further settling.

Pier and beam repair - lifts and supports homes with compromised pier and beam systems.

Mudjacking and slab leveling - raises sunken concrete slabs to restore level surfaces.

Soil stabilization - improves soil conditions to reduce future foundation movement.

Crack injection - seals fo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ion and structural issues.

Drainage correction - addresses water issues that contribute to foundation settling.

Sinking Foundation Repair Questions

What are signs of a sinking foundation? Common signs include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around frames or trim.

What causes a foundation to sink? Foundation sinking can result from soil movement, poor drainage, or inadequate soil compaction beneath the structure.

How is sinking foundation repair performed? Repairs often involve underpinning, pier installation, or soil stabilization to restore stability and level the foundation.

Is foundation sinking a serious issue? Yes, it can lead to structural damage if left unaddressed, affecting the safety and value of a property.
